본 발명은 자동차의 전면 양축에 취부되어 야간운행시 전방을 비추도록 하는 전조등에 관한 것으로서, 커브길 운행시 회전방향을 따라 전조등이 회동되어 운전자가 도로상황을 용이하게 관측할 수 있도록 하는 전조등의 각도전환 조절장치에 관한 것이다.The present invention relates to a headlight mounted on both front surfaces of a vehicle to illuminate the front during night driving, and the headlight is rotated along a rotational direction when driving a curve road so that the driver can easily observe the road situation. It relates to a switching control device.

일반적으로 자동차는 차체(10)의 전면 하부에 위치되는 구동측(21)의 양단부에 바퀴(20)가 회전 가능하게 장치되고, 조향장치의 조향기어(22) 끝단부가 바퀴(20)의 내측에 형성된 너클에 회동구동이 가능하게 연결되어, 구동축(21)을 통해 전달되는 동력에 의해 바퀴(20)가 회전되고, 조향장치의 조작에 따라 조향기어(22)가 너클을 통해 바퀴(20)의 방향을 전환시켜 차량의 진행방향을 조절하게 된다.In general, an automobile is provided with wheels 20 rotatably mounted at both ends of a driving side 21 located at a lower portion of the front of the vehicle body 10, and an end of a steering gear 22 of the steering apparatus is located inside the wheel 20. FIG. Rotating driving is connected to the formed knuckle, the wheel 20 is rotated by the power transmitted through the drive shaft 21, and the steering gear 22 of the wheel 20 through the knuckle according to the operation of the steering device The direction of the vehicle is adjusted by changing the direction.

한편, 이러한 자동차는 차체(10)의 전면부 양측에 각기 전조등(30)이 차체(10) 정면의 전방을 향하도록 하여 차체에 고정되어, 스위치를 조작하면 전원이 전조등(30)에 통전되어 점등된 전조등(30)의 불빛이 차량의 전방을 비추게 되며, 야간 운행시 전조등(30)을 점등시켜 전방을 비추도록 하므로 운행이 가능하도록 한다.On the other hand, such a vehicle is fixed to the vehicle body with the headlamps 30 facing the front of the vehicle body 10 in front of both sides of the front of the vehicle body 10, the power is supplied to the headlight 30 when the switch is operated. The lights of the headlights 30 are used to illuminate the front of the vehicle, so that the vehicle can be operated by lighting the front headlights 30 during the night driving.

그러나 이러한 종래 자동차는 전조등(30)이 차체(10)에 고정된 상태로 있어, 전조등(30)의 불빛이 차량의 정면 전방만 비추기 때문에, 야간 커브길 운행시 운전자가 운행하려는 방향의 도로상황파악이 어렵고, 커브가 심할수록 원거리 관측이 불가하여 불편함이 있을 뿐아니라, 안전사고의 위험까지 따르는 문제점이 있었다.However, such a conventional vehicle has the headlight 30 fixed to the vehicle body 10, and the light of the headlight 30 only illuminates the front side of the vehicle, so that the road situation in the direction in which the driver intends to drive when driving at night curve roads is detected. This difficult, severe curve is not possible to observe the long distance is not only uncomfortable, there was a problem that follows the risk of safety accidents.

본 발명은 상기 종래와 같은 문제점을 해소하기 위해, 기존 조향장치와 전조등 사이에 링크장치를 부가시켜 차량의 운행방향으로 전조등이 회전되도록 하므로, 야간운행시 전조등의 불빛이 회전방향으로 비치도록 하고, 더불어 조향장치의 직진 조향성 및 안정성이 향상되도록 하는 데 그 목적이 있다.The present invention, in order to solve the problems as described above, by adding a link device between the existing steering device and the headlights so that the headlights rotate in the driving direction of the vehicle, so that the lights of the headlights in the rotational direction during the night driving, In addition, the aim is to improve the straight steering and stability of the steering system.

먼저, 본 발명의 자동차도 제3도에 도시되는 바와 같이, 차체(10) 전면 하부에 위치되는 구동측(21)의 양단부에 바퀴(20)가 회전 가능하게 장치되고, 조향장치의 조향기어(22) 끝단부가 바퀴(20)의 내측에 형성된 너클에 회동구동이 가능하게 연결되는 것과; 차체(10)의 전면부 양측에 각기 전조등(30)이 차체(10)에 지지되는 것은 종래와 같다.First, as shown in FIG. 3 of the automobile of the present invention, the wheels 20 are rotatably installed at both ends of the driving side 21 positioned below the front of the vehicle body 10, and the steering gear of the steering apparatus ( 22) the end portion is rotatably connected to the knuckle formed inside the wheel 20; The headlamps 30 are respectively supported on the vehicle body 10 on both sides of the front portion of the vehicle body 10 as in the related art.

단, 본 발명은 전조등(30)의 상단과 저면부가 힌지에 의해 차체(10)에 회동 가능하게 지지되어, 전조등(30)의 일측면이 구동링크(41)의 일단부에 회전구동이 가능하게 연결되고, 구동링크(41)의 타단부가 유압실린더(40)의 일단부에 연동 가능하게 힌지연결되며, 유압실린더(40)의 타단부가 조향기어(22)에 힌지연결됨을 그 기술적 구성상의 기본 특징으로 한다.However, in the present invention, the upper end and the bottom of the headlamp 30 are rotatably supported by the vehicle body 10 by the hinge, so that one side of the headlamp 30 can be rotated at one end of the drive link 41. The other end of the drive link 41 is hingedly connected to one end of the hydraulic cylinder 40, and the other end of the hydraulic cylinder 40 is hinged to the steering gear 22. It is a basic feature.

여기에서, 유압실린더(40)는 제4도에 도시되는 바와 같이, 중심부에 회전중심축(42)이 관통되어 차체에 지지되고, 회전중심축(42)과 조향기어(22)의 연결부 사이에 오일이 내장되는 실린더가 형성되어 실린더 내부에 피스톤(44)과 일체로 연동되게 장착되는 피스톤로드(43)가 힌지에 의해 조향기어(22)에 연결된다.Here, as shown in FIG. 4, the hydraulic cylinder 40 is supported by the vehicle body through the rotation center shaft 42 passing through the center thereof, and is connected between the rotation center shaft 42 and the connection portion of the steering gear 22. A cylinder in which oil is built is formed, and a piston rod 43 mounted integrally with the piston 44 in the cylinder is connected to the steering gear 22 by a hinge.

이와같이 구성되는 본 발명은, 조향장치를 조작하면 조향기어(22)가 좌우로 이동함에 따라 유압실린더(40)의 피스톤로드(43)가 연동하게 되고, 피스톤로드(43)가 이동함에 따라 유압실린더(40)가 회전중심축(42)을 중심으로 회동하게 되며, 이로인해 유압실린더(40) 일단부에 연결된 구동링크(41)가 연동되어 전조등(30)이 힌지를 중심으로 소정각도 회동되도록 한다. 이때 전조등(30)의 회전각도는 조향기어(22)에 의해 유압실린더(40)와 구동링크(41)가 기구적으로 구동되므로 바퀴(20)의 조향각도 만큼 바퀴(20)의 조향방향으로 조절되게 된다.According to the present invention configured as described above, when the steering gear 22 is moved, the piston rod 43 of the hydraulic cylinder 40 is interlocked as the steering gear 22 moves to the left and right, and the hydraulic cylinder is moved as the piston rod 43 moves. 40 is rotated about the center of rotation axis 42, thereby driving the drive link 41 connected to one end of the hydraulic cylinder 40 is interlocked so that the headlamp 30 is rotated by a predetermined angle around the hinge. . At this time, since the hydraulic cylinder 40 and the driving link 41 are mechanically driven by the steering gear 22, the rotation angle of the headlamp 30 is adjusted in the steering direction of the wheel 20 by the steering angle of the wheel 20. Will be.

한편, 유압실린더(40)는 피스톤로드(43)의 작동이 실린더 내부의 오일속을 이동하는 피스톤(44)과 연계되어 구동충격이 오일에 흡수되도록 하므로 전조등(30)의 구동이 부드럽도록 하고, 더불어 조향기어(22)의 구동에도 억제력이 작용하게 되어 고속주행시 조향장치의 직진 조향성 및 안정감이 향상되도록 한다.On the other hand, the hydraulic cylinder 40 is connected to the piston 44 moving the oil in the cylinder operation of the piston rod 43 so that the driving shock is absorbed in the oil so that the driving of the headlamp 30 is smooth, In addition, the suppression force acts on the driving of the steering gear 22 so that the steering and stability of the straight steering of the steering apparatus is improved during high-speed driving.

상기와 같이 구성되고 작동되는 본 발명은, 기존 조향장치에 링크장치를 부가시켜 차량의 운향방향으로 전조등이 회전되도록 하므로, 야간운행시 편리성이 향상되도록 하고, 유압실린더의 기능에 의해 조향장치의 직진 조향성 및 안정성과 향상되도록 하는 효과가 있다.The present invention constructed and operated as described above, by adding a link device to the existing steering device to rotate the headlight in the direction of the vehicle's direction of movement, to improve the convenience at night driving, the function of the hydraulic cylinder by the function of the hydraulic cylinder There is an effect to improve the straight steering and stability.
